mx05.arcai.com

tic tac toe math

M

MX05.ARCAI.COM NETWORK

Updated: March 26, 2026

Tic Tac Toe Math: Exploring the Numbers Behind the Classic Game

tic tac toe math might not be the first thing that comes to mind when you think about this simple, childhood favorite game. Yet, beneath the seemingly straightforward 3x3 grid lies a fascinating world of mathematics, strategy, and logic. Whether you're a casual player or a math enthusiast, understanding the numerical and combinatorial aspects of tic tac toe can deepen your appreciation for the game and even improve your skills.

In this article, we’ll dive into the math behind tic tac toe, exploring concepts from game theory, combinatorics, and logic. We’ll discuss why the game always ends in a draw with perfect play, how the number of possible game states is calculated, and how learning these mathematical principles can make you a more strategic player.

The Mathematics Behind Tic Tac Toe

At first glance, tic tac toe seems like a game of luck or simple pattern recognition. However, it’s an excellent example of a solved game—one where the outcome can be predicted given optimal play from both players. The foundation of this predictability lies in the math that governs the game’s structure.

Game Theory and Tic Tac Toe

Game theory, a branch of mathematics focused on strategic interactions, provides the framework to analyze tic tac toe mathematically. In game theory terms, tic tac toe is a two-player zero-sum game with perfect information—meaning both players know the entire state of the game at all times.

Using game theory, mathematicians have proven that if both players make optimal moves, the game will always end in a draw. This is because every move creates a limited number of possible future board configurations, and the game tree can be fully explored to determine the best possible move at each turn.

The Game Tree and Possible Outcomes

One of the most intriguing aspects of tic tac toe math is calculating the total number of possible games and board states. The game tree for tic tac toe starts with an empty board and branches out with each possible move.

  • The total number of possible unique board configurations is 765.
  • Considering all possible sequences of moves, there are 255,168 possible games.

This disparity arises because many sequences lead to the same final board state, and some moves are equivalent due to symmetries such as rotations and reflections.

Understanding the game tree’s size helps computer scientists design algorithms that can play tic tac toe perfectly. It also illustrates the manageable complexity of the game compared to other board games like chess or Go.

Using Combinatorics to Understand Tic Tac Toe

Combinatorics, the study of counting and arrangements, plays a crucial role in tic tac toe math. It helps us understand the number of ways players can place their marks and the probability of various outcomes.

Counting Possible Moves and Winning Lines

The 3x3 grid offers nine positions where players alternate marking Xs and Os. Combinatorics allows us to calculate how many ways these marks can be arranged.

  • Each player has up to five moves (X starts first).
  • The number of ways to arrange marks without considering turn order is large, but many are invalid due to the turn-taking rule.

Moreover, tic tac toe has 8 winning lines:

  • 3 horizontal rows
  • 3 vertical columns
  • 2 diagonals

Recognizing these winning lines mathematically helps players focus on strategic spots on the board and anticipate potential threats.

Probability and Strategy

While tic tac toe is deterministic with perfect play, beginners often make random or suboptimal moves. Using basic probability, we can estimate the chances of winning or tying based on random play.

For example, if both players choose their moves randomly, the likelihood of a draw is relatively low compared to when players use strategy. This insight highlights the importance of understanding the math behind the game to outperform casual opponents.

Applying Tic Tac Toe Math to Improve Your Game

Knowing the math behind tic tac toe isn’t just for academics—it can directly enhance your gameplay. By leveraging mathematical principles, you can develop winning strategies and avoid common pitfalls.

Optimal Opening Moves

Mathematical analysis shows that the best opening move is to take the center square. The center gives you the highest number of potential winning lines (4), compared to corner or edge squares.

If you start in the corner, your opponent can force a draw more easily. This insight comes directly from understanding the geometry and combinatorics of the board.

Recognizing Threats and Forks

A “fork” in tic tac toe is a position where a player creates two simultaneous threats, forcing the opponent to block one and lose the other. Tic tac toe math reveals how these forks arise from the arrangement of Xs and Os.

By visualizing the possible winning lines and intersections mathematically, players can anticipate forks and plan moves to either create or block them. This level of strategic thinking separates casual players from experts.

Tic Tac Toe Math in Computer Science and AI

The simplicity of tic tac toe makes it a perfect introduction to artificial intelligence (AI) and game programming. Understanding the math behind the game is essential for developing AI that can play perfectly.

Minimax Algorithm and Tic Tac Toe

The minimax algorithm, a classic AI technique, uses tic tac toe’s game tree to evaluate all possible moves and select the one that minimizes the potential loss. By recursively exploring possible game states and assigning values (win, lose, draw), AI can choose the optimal move.

The success of minimax in tic tac toe is a direct result of the manageable size of the game tree and the clear mathematical structure of the game.

Teaching Programming Concepts with Tic Tac Toe Math

Many programming courses use tic tac toe to teach concepts like recursion, backtracking, and state evaluation. Understanding the mathematical principles helps learners grasp how to represent game states and implement decision-making algorithms.

This practical application of math makes tic tac toe an enduring educational tool in computer science.

Exploring Variations and Extended Tic Tac Toe Math

While the classic 3x3 game is well understood, mathematicians and enthusiasts have explored larger and more complex versions of tic tac toe, often called m,n,k-games, where the board is m by n and k in a row wins.

Complexity of Larger Boards

As the board size increases, the number of possible game states and winning lines grows exponentially, making the math far more complex.

For example:

  • On a 4x4 board, the number of possible games skyrockets.
  • Winning requires 4 in a row instead of 3, altering strategic considerations.

Studying these variations introduces advanced combinatorics and computational challenges that continue to interest mathematicians and game theorists.

Mathematical Challenges in Generalized Tic Tac Toe

Determining the outcome of generalized tic tac toe games is a challenging problem. In some cases, the first player can force a win; in others, the game is biased toward a draw or second player advantage.

Research in this area involves deep mathematical insights into combinatorial game theory and computational complexity, demonstrating how a simple game can lead to rich mathematical investigations.


Tic tac toe math offers a surprising depth beneath a familiar pastime. From game theory and combinatorics to AI and beyond, the numbers and logic behind tic tac toe provide valuable lessons in strategy, mathematics, and computer science. Whether you want to sharpen your playing skills or explore the mathematical beauty of games, diving into tic tac toe math is a rewarding endeavor.

In-Depth Insights

Tic Tac Toe Math: The Subtle Mathematics Behind a Classic Game

tic tac toe math reveals a fascinating interplay between simple gameplay and complex mathematical principles. Often dismissed as a trivial pastime for children, this classic pen-and-paper game actually embodies rich strategic depth that can be explored through mathematical analysis. From combinatorial game theory to matrix representation and algorithmic solutions, tic tac toe serves as an accessible entry point to understand broader concepts in mathematics and computer science.

The Mathematical Structure of Tic Tac Toe

At its core, tic tac toe is played on a 3x3 grid, where two players alternate marking spaces with Xs and Os. The objective is to align three identical symbols horizontally, vertically, or diagonally. While the rules appear straightforward, the underlying mathematics is surprisingly intricate.

In terms of combinatorics, the game’s state space encompasses all possible arrangements of Xs, Os, and empty cells on the board. The total number of possible board configurations is 3^9 = 19,683, since each of the nine cells can be in one of three states: empty, X, or O. However, many of these states are invalid due to the alternating turn structure and winning conditions, reducing the meaningful game states to roughly 5,478. This reduction is critical when analyzing game outcomes or designing algorithms to play perfectly.

Game Theory and Optimal Play

Tic tac toe is a classic example of a solved game. Game theory provides tools to analyze optimal strategies for both players. The game is zero-sum and turn-based, with perfect information, meaning all players can see the entire game state at all times.

Mathematically, the game can be represented as a decision tree where each node corresponds to a game state and edges represent possible moves. By applying minimax algorithms with alpha-beta pruning, players can evaluate the best possible moves to either win or at least force a draw. This ensures that tic tac toe, when played optimally by both parties, will always end in a tie.

The “tic tac toe math” behind these algorithms involves recursive evaluation of game states, assigning heuristic scores to terminal nodes (win, lose, draw), and back-propagating those scores to determine the best move. This approach is foundational in artificial intelligence research and forms the basis for more complex game-solving programs.

Matrix Representation and Linear Algebra Applications

Beyond combinatorics and game theory, tic tac toe can also be examined through the lens of linear algebra. The 3x3 grid naturally maps to a 3x3 matrix, where each cell’s state can be encoded numerically (for example, 1 for X, -1 for O, and 0 for empty).

Using this matrix form allows for the application of vector operations to detect winning conditions efficiently. For instance, summing rows, columns, or diagonals can determine if a player has achieved three identical marks. If the sum of any row, column, or diagonal equals 3 or -3 (depending on encoding), it indicates a win for X or O, respectively.

This numeric approach simplifies the logic for programmatic implementations and highlights how tic tac toe math intersects with matrix manipulation and pattern recognition. It also serves as an educational tool for students to connect abstract algebraic concepts with tangible examples.

Symmetry and Board Transformations

An interesting facet of tic tac toe math is the role of symmetry in reducing complexity. The 3x3 board exhibits rotational and reflectional symmetry, meaning that many board states are equivalent under these transformations.

By identifying and grouping symmetric states, mathematicians and computer scientists can significantly prune the state space. This reduction optimizes algorithmic performance by avoiding redundant calculations.

For example, a corner move on the top-left is symmetric to a corner move on the top-right if the board is rotated 90 degrees. Recognizing these equivalences is a subtle but powerful aspect of tic tac toe math that demonstrates how symmetry can be leveraged in problem-solving.

Educational Implications and Practical Uses

Tic tac toe math is not just an academic curiosity but also a valuable educational resource. Its simplicity paired with underlying complexity makes it an excellent tool for teaching logical thinking, strategic planning, and basic programming.

Educators often use tic tac toe to introduce students to algorithm design, decision trees, and even artificial intelligence concepts like minimax search. The game’s small state space allows for hands-on experimentation without overwhelming learners, providing immediate feedback and motivation.

Furthermore, understanding the mathematics behind tic tac toe can inspire curiosity about other combinatorial games and puzzles, fostering deeper engagement with STEM fields.

Limitations and Challenges

While tic tac toe math offers valuable insights, it also has inherent limitations. The small board size and simple rules create a constrained problem space that can be solved exhaustively. This predictability means the game lacks long-term strategic depth compared to more complex games like chess or Go.

Additionally, the deterministic nature of tic tac toe means that once both players know the optimal strategy, the game inevitably results in a draw, which can reduce its appeal as a competitive challenge.

However, these limitations do not diminish its usefulness as a mathematical model or educational tool; rather, they highlight the importance of scaling mathematical concepts appropriately to different contexts.

Computational Complexity and Algorithmic Approaches

From a computational standpoint, tic tac toe math illustrates fundamental concepts in algorithm design and complexity theory. The game’s decision tree size is manageable, making brute-force search feasible, but optimization techniques remain essential for efficient play.

Algorithms like minimax explore all possible moves to choose the optimal one, but their efficiency improves dramatically with alpha-beta pruning, which cuts off branches that cannot influence the final decision. This pruning reduces the number of evaluated states from thousands to just hundreds, demonstrating a practical application of theoretical computer science principles.

Moreover, tic tac toe has been used as a testing ground for reinforcement learning algorithms, where AI agents learn to play through trial and error, gradually improving their performance without explicit programming of strategies.

Comparisons with Other Mathematical Games

Comparing tic tac toe math to other mathematical games reveals both its simplicity and foundational importance. Games like Connect Four, Nim, and Hex involve more complex state spaces and strategic depth but often build upon similar mathematical frameworks.

For example, Nim utilizes combinatorial game theory and the concept of nimbers, while Connect Four’s larger grid increases complexity and introduces new winning patterns. Tic tac toe’s role as a pedagogical stepping stone cannot be overstated, providing a baseline understanding before moving on to these advanced games.

This progression illustrates how mathematical analysis of simple games can scale to inform the study of intricate competitive environments.

Tic tac toe math, therefore, offers a compelling intersection of recreational gameplay and serious mathematical inquiry. Its study illuminates essential principles ranging from combinatorics and game theory to matrix algebra and algorithmic efficiency. Whether approached as a classroom exercise or a research subject, the game’s mathematical underpinnings continue to enrich our understanding of strategy, computation, and problem-solving.

💡 Frequently Asked Questions

How can tic tac toe be used to teach basic math concepts?

Tic tac toe can be used to teach basic math concepts such as pattern recognition, strategic thinking, and spatial reasoning by encouraging players to plan moves ahead and recognize winning combinations.

What is the mathematical probability of winning tic tac toe if both players play optimally?

If both players play optimally, the probability of either player winning tic tac toe is zero, resulting in a guaranteed draw.

Can tic tac toe be represented using matrices in math?

Yes, tic tac toe can be represented using a 3x3 matrix where each cell contains a value indicating an empty space, X, or O, allowing mathematical analysis of the game state.

How does combinatorics apply to tic tac toe?

Combinatorics applies to tic tac toe by calculating the total number of possible game states and move sequences, which helps in analyzing all potential outcomes of the game.

What is the total number of possible unique tic tac toe games?

There are 255,168 possible unique tic tac toe games considering all move sequences, though many are symmetrical or equivalent under rotation and reflection.

How can tic tac toe be used to explain game theory in math?

Tic tac toe serves as a simple example of game theory by illustrating concepts like optimal strategies, Nash equilibrium, and zero-sum games, where players aim to maximize their own outcome.

Is there a mathematical strategy to always win or draw tic tac toe?

Yes, there is a mathematical strategy involving controlling the center, creating forks, and blocking opponent moves to ensure a win or at least a draw in tic tac toe.

How can tic tac toe be extended to explore higher-dimensional math concepts?

Tic tac toe can be extended to 3D or higher dimensions, such as a 3x3x3 cube, to explore more complex geometric and combinatorial concepts, increasing the game's complexity and strategic depth.

Explore Related Topics

#tic tac toe strategy
#tic tac toe probability
#tic tac toe game theory
#tic tac toe combinatorics
#tic tac toe patterns
#tic tac toe algorithms
#tic tac toe logic
#tic tac toe winning moves
#tic tac toe mathematics
#tic tac toe puzzles